Project December......3 x 4 Journal Cards

Hey there.  Things are moving quickly here on my blog this month.  I'll be posting something new nearly every day so be sure to scroll down to see if you missed any posts.  Today I'm sharing the 3 x 4 journal cards that I'll be using for the month my Project December pages....Project Life + Daily December all combined into one album. Since last year's December Daily is still sitting in a box unfinished I wanted to work ahead this year and be more prepared.  

These are the results of several sessions of creating 3 x 4 journal cards.  I moved my holiday product pick units to my craft table and just sifted through all the goodies.  
 There is definitely a holiday vibe but many of the journal cards are very neutral in nature too.  I wanted to create a balance so that for the weeks leading up to Christmas, I could pick cards that are more for everyday activities.  My journal cards at this point are very clean and simple.  I've learned that when creating handmade journal cards that I like to keep a lot of open space so that I can add a small photo and/or lots of journaling.  This is why you see mainly strips of patterned paper or tags added to the tops and sides of the journal cards only.  As I'm assembling my inserts I will add on the fun embellishments.
 One thing you might take note of is that I used red machine stitching on nearly every journal card.  Red is going to be a signature color for my December pages so I thought the stitching would tie everything together even though the cards are very mixy matchy.  I'll continue to add the red stitching to inserts that I add throughout the month too.  Tip:  If you want to change out thread colors in your sewing machine...say to use a green or a white....simply use a white/cream color for the bobbin. Then just switch out the spool color to whatever you want. 
If you count up my 3 x 4 cards there are definitely more than I need for just my regular weekly Project Life pages.  The page protectors that I chose to add as inserts have lots of 3 x 4 slots also I made extra.  Some of these cards would make layering pieces for holiday cards and I might use some for gift tags also.  These would look great with a to/from stamp and a strip of Washi tap layered over the top and taped to a Kraft   paper wrapped package.  And if there's lots left over this holiday, I plan to use them to create holiday thank you cards.  People still make thank you cards, right?
